Chinanews, Beijing, Aug. 24 – Li Liguo, vice1 minister of civil affairs, said on Wednesday that China had helped 1.3 million mendicants in 2006, and the ministry3 didn't think to be a mendicant2 could be regarded as a job.
Li said that China's salvation4 stations had also helped some 100 thousand young mendicants. He said that Chinese government had tried its best to help these people. He thought poverty might be a factor during them to mendicancy5, but he also indicated that some hooligans controlled these mendicants to make profits.
